Standards and WCAG 2.1 AA Compliance
Our website is developed with reference to the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ines version 2.1, aiming to meet Level AA success criteria. These guidelines are widely recognised as the international standard for web accessibility and are designed to make online content more perceivable, operable, understandable, and robust for all users.
While we continuously work toward full WCAG 2.1 AA compliance, some areas of the site may not yet fully meet every requirement. We are actively reviewing and improving our content, structure, and code to increase compliance over time.

Keyboard Navigation
Our website is built to support users who navigate using a keyboard rather than a mouse or touch screen. Interactive elements are intended to be reachable using standard keyboard commands such as the Tab, Shift plus Tab, Enter, and Space keys. Focus indicators are designed to make it clear which element is currently selected.
If you find any part of the site where you cannot access information or complete tasks using only a keyboard, we would like to hear about your experience so we can improve the accessibility of those features.
